The Comox Bay Sailing Club (CBSC) was founded by a group of local sailing enthusiasts in 1965. 2015 marks the 50th anniversary of the Club!
A fleet of Signet dinghies was acquired at that time – and so the start of a sailboat racing heritage was borne in the Comox Valley. A number of the founding members still live in the Valley, and speak nostalgically about those days. In time, a few members graduated to larger, enclosed boats with fixed ballast, and a keelboat racing fleet emerged. The original Signets were replaced with Sabots and Flying Juniors, a 14-foot dinghy designed for 2 people.
Today the Comox Bay Sailing Club owns a fleet of 420 and Laser sailing dinghies. These dinghies are actively used by our sailing school, the race team and by club members for both recreational and competitive sailing.
